The time period sterility is normally an complete term – which means the entire absence of practical microorganisms in a product or in an natural environment. But in observe, the sterility of a product is outlined via the absence of feasible and actively multiplying microorganisms when examined in specified culture (nutrient) media that supports The expansion of the microbes.

3. Incubation: Soon after filtration or inoculation, the society media that contains the samples are incubated under correct problems to promote The expansion of any feasible microorganisms. Incubation periods might range dependant upon the regulatory guidelines and the character with the merchandise staying examined.

Sterile, enclosed units allow with the simultaneous filtration of equivalent volumes of test samples by way of two membrane filters. Samples are then incubated in two kinds of media (TSB and FTM) for 14 times, facilitating the detection of both of those aerobic and anaerobic microorganisms.
